Foundation Slab Construction in Fredericksburg, VA
Foundation slab construction involves pouring a solid concrete base that serves as the foundation for a building or addition. This service is essential for residential projects such as new homes, extensions, garages, or patios. Property owners typically want to understand the importance of a properly constructed slab in providing stability, preventing settling, and supporting the weight of the structure. Before requesting foundation slab work, homeowners often inquire about the site preparation process, the materials used, and how the slab will be reinforced to ensure durability and long-term performance.
Understanding the scope of foundation slab construction includes knowing how the project addresses soil conditions, drainage, and proper curing techniques. Property owners should consider factors such as the size and thickness of the slab, the type of concrete mix, and whether additional features like control joints or insulation are included. Clarifying these details helps ensure the foundation meets the specific needs of the property and provides a stable base for future construction or renovations.

Foundation Slab Construction Questions
What is a foundation slab? A foundation slab is a flat concrete surface that supports the structure of a building, providing stability and levelness for the property.
When is a foundation slab necessary? It is typically used in areas with stable soil and is suitable for residential buildings, garages, and additions requiring a durable, level base.
What factors influence the construction of a foundation slab? Soil type, property size, and building design are key factors that determine the thickness, reinforcement, and placement of a slab.
How long does a foundation slab last? With proper construction and maintenance, a foundation slab can provide reliable support for many decades.
